BEGIN_PROP_MAP

BEGIN_PROP_MAP ( theClass )

Paramètres

theClass

[en] Spécifie la classe contenant la carte de propriété.

Remarques

Marque le début de la carte de propriété de l'objet. La carte de propriété stocke les descriptions de propriété, propriété DISPID, page de propriétés CLSID et IDispatch iid. Les classes IPerPropertyBrowsingImpl, IPersistPropertyBagImpl, IPersistStreamInitImplet ISpecifyPropertyPagesImpl utilisent le mappage des propriétés pour récupérer et définir cette information.

Lorsque vous créez un objet avec l'Assistant objet ATL, l'Assistant va créer une carte de propriété vide en spécifiant BEGIN_PROP_MAP suivi par END_PROP_MAP.

BEGIN_PROP_MAP n'enregistre pas sur la mesure (c'est-à-dire, les dimensions) d'une carte de propriété, car un objet à l'aide d'une carte de propriété peut-être pas une interface utilisateur, donc il n'aurait aucune importance. Si l'objet est un contrôle ActiveX avec une interface utilisateur, elle a une étendue. Dans ce cas, vous devez spécifier PROP_DATA_ENTRY de votre carte de propriété pour fournir la mesure.

Voir aussi

Les Macros ATL et fonctions globales

Index